    I'm happy to hear the surgery went well for you, David. I had it done on both eyes (a few weeks apart) a few years ago and couldn't believe what I wasn't seeing! The prep for the surgery took longer than the actual proceedure and people don't believe I never felt a thing. The doctor was laughing during the second surgery because, he said, I was dozing off.     Congratulations! I had to watch myself for the first week i.e. no heavy lifting, not touching my left eye for a week, but it was worth it, I'm 20/20 with my glasses and 20/25 without them.
